Non-spicy hotpot broth base:

1 Chinese Raddish
1 Carrot
500g Pork Bone // Beef Bone (can be replaced by all sorts of mushroom)

  • Cover pork bone with water, boil for 3 mins, drain the water and put the pork bone under running water
  • Chop up raddish and carrot; put raddish, carrot and pork bone in Food Party Hot Pot; cover up with water; until boil
  • let the broth simmer for 30mins and it's ready

Szechuan hotpot broth base:

  • With vegetable oil, stir fry chilli paste, chili powder, and crushed chilli with Food Party Hot Pot
  • Pour in the non-spicy broth base, let it simmer and it's ready

Easy broth base preparation:

There are lots of pre-made broth base in the market, be it Szechuan spicy flavor or even tomato soup flavor. Go to your local Asian supermarket and look for brands like Haidilao, Little Lamb, and others.

There's really no rule about dipping sauces! 

A few common ingredients for people to mix and match together are: crushed chili, coriander, scallion, soy sauce, hoisin sauce, sesame paste, chili oil, sesame oil, garlic, sesame seed, oyster sauce. Looking for some easier options? Asian markets offer pre-made dipping sauces from hotpot brand like Haidilao and Little Lamb!
